Job Description

Behavioral Health Team Lead

Triplemoon

• Serve as the first point of contact for BHCMs on day-to-day operational and care delivery questions • Monitor team schedules, caseload distribution, and daily workflows to ensure consistent patient coverage • Support BHCMs in navigating complex patient situations, escalating to the Director of Behavioral Health and Chief Clinical Officer as appropriate • Promote a culture of accountability, clinical excellence, and psychological safety across the BHCM team • Conduct regular check-ins with individual BHCMs to surface operational barriers and support team morale • Conduct regular shadow sessions with BHCMs, providing structured, real-time feedback on clinical delivery and documentation • Complete chart audits to assess documentation quality, care cadence adherence, and registry accuracy • Identify patterns in quality gaps and escalate systemic issues to the Director of Behavioral Health • Support rollout and adherence to updated clinical workflows and SOPs as developed by the Manager of Education, Curriculum & Credentialing Registry Review Support • Attend weekly registry review meetings led by the Sr. Manager of Psychiatry • Capture and follow up on action items from registry review, coordinating with BHCMs to ensure timely implementation • Monitor patient engagement against clinical cadence guidelines and flag outliers for discussion at registry review • Serve as an operational liaison between the BHCM team and clinical leadership, surfacing workflow friction points and improvement opportunities • Support onboarding of new BHCMs in coordination with the Director of Behavioral Health and Manager of Education, Curriculum & Credentialing • Contribute to the development and refinement of clinical operating procedures based on day-to-day team experience • Assist in tracking BHCM performance metrics and provide input to the Director of Behavioral Health for performance management processes

Job Requirements

  • Active clinical licensure (LCSW, LPC, LMFT, or equivalent) in at least one Triplemoon-supported state
  • Minimum 3 years of direct clinical experience in a behavioral health setting
  • Prior experience in a Collaborative Care Model (CoCM) or integrated behavioral health environment strongly preferred
  • Demonstrated ability to provide peer coaching, feedback, or informal leadership to clinical colleagues
  • Strong organizational skills and comfort managing multiple competing priorities in a fast-paced, remote environment
  • Proficiency with EHR platforms and registry-based care management workflows
  • Experience in a supervisory, lead, or team coordination role preferred
  • Familiarity with CMS documentation standards and billing-eligible encounter requirements under CoCM
  • Multi-state licensure or willingness to obtain licensure across Triplemoon's supported states
  • Experience with PHQ, GAD-7, PSC-17, or other standardized behavioral health screeners
